The 350 did not appear until 1958. All 1958 engines would have an ID letter prefix of "L". In 1957, the Dodge engine choices were flathead 6, a poly 325 CID ("KDS" prefix), and the 325 Hemi ("KD500" prefix). There was also a Chrysler hemi (354 CID) offered as a "KD501" option.
